transmission fluid

How do you check the tranny fluid?

remove the square plug in the side of the tranny. level should be right up to the hole. fair warning tho, some ppl overtighten this plug so u may need to use both hands and a foot for leverage.

jack up the car and make sure it is level at all four corners (a lift works wonders for this) and remove the fill plug on the left side of the trans. it can be removed using the open end of a 14mm wrench. using your first or little finger, poke in the hole and downward at a 90 degree angle. the fluid should be to the bottom of the fill hole. boos says 1.8 quarts but i use 2 and i use redline mt 90.
